Homemade Alcohol Kills - In Libya


There have been five hundred and fifty one people poisoned by homemade alcohol. Fifty-one of these people have died. This was allowed to take place because alcohol is illegal in Libya. Because of the laws of Islam, these people who choose to partake in what we as Americans can acknowledge as an accepted freedom in western culture, ultimately died. The problems were caused by an amount of methanol in the alcohol. It caused blindness, and several different types of organ failure in some patients.
